Which dictatorships hire Public Relations (PR) firms, under what conditions, and with what effects?
Christian Gläßel, Alex Dukalskis, and I offer first answers with data on 7k contracts between autocracies and US-based PR firms (1945–2022).

Pleased to see my paper on placebo tests (with Guadalupe Tuñón and Allan Dafoe) published at AJPS
We provide a definition of placebo tests, a typology of test types, a theory of what makes them informative, & a review and critique of common tests 1/
